How to Approach and Connect with Professors
I have had several requests for a post on approaching and connecting with your law school professors. I totally understand why people wonder about this- it is so easy to be intimidated by law school professors when you first start law school. These people are so smart and accomplished and it is hard to feel like you can approach them when you feel like you know absolutely nothing. However, if you never overcome this, you will miss out on a really beneficial process of learning from the professor and connecting with them outside of class as potential references.
The connections I have made with professors during law school has been one of my favorite parts of the process. Beyond the fact that I learn so much from them, my professors have helped me with issues in my personal and professional life. Getting over being intimidated allowed me to get to know my professors and form connections that lead to much better references. Here are my tips for approaching and connecting with your law school professors.

Why I do a Monthly Meal Plan
I am on Spring Break this week and it has been a very welcome reprieve in a very busy semester. I finally have time to do a few projects around the house, catch up on my reading list, watch some TV, catch up on my outlines and get some much needed extra sleep.
Another thing I have done over Spring Break is make a meal plan for the month of March. I have talked about meal planning on the blog before (See this post)- that post has a lot more info about the exact process and tips for starting out with meal prepping as a beginner. I credit meal planning with saving my sanity and my waistline regularly. Basically, meal planning means that you make a list of meals for either the week or the month and then you just get home and have dinner planned. Meal planning helps me save money when shopping because I buy ingredients I can use multiple times throughout the week and it saves us money because we go out to eat less/order in less.
